    The Food and Drug Administration, Global Mix, Inc,and World Green Nutrition, Inc have recalled tejocote and herbal supplements sold under the following brands: Eva Nutrition, Science of Alpha, Niwali, NWL Nutra, and ELV Control Herbal Supplement. Though labeled as containing tejocote root or other herbs, they contain the highly toxic yellow oleander that triggers neurological, gastrointestinal, and cardiovascular consequences that may be severe and fatal.


    These tejocote supplements were sold in: Alabama, Alaska, California, Colorado, Connecticut, Delaware, Florida, Georgia, Hawaii, Idaho, Illinois, Iowa, Indiana, Kansas, Kentucky, Louisiana,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Mississippi, Missouri, Montana, Nebraska, Nevada, New Mexico, New Carolina, New York, New Jersey, North Dakota, Ohio, Oklahoma, Oregon,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, Virginia, Washington, West Virginia, Wisconsin, and Wyoming. They were sold sold online at: Etsy.com, amazon.com, Eva-nutrition.com, tejocotemexican.com, Niwali.com, and scienceofalpha.com.


    Do not use these products. Return them to the place of purchase for a full refund or an uncontaminated product.
